Output 8d6ab40d3467575bd73ea0efe521f5fde5d375688fb88cc3ad44fd1481e3ae6f:704

value
105963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 066fb9bda88bb76ee7ee80388e40db62c251a7c4 OP_EQUAL
address
32H3pXET6M1keBhFUxirobsxNXwuMhqNNF
transaction
8d6ab40d3467575bd73ea0efe521f5fde5d375688fb88cc3ad44fd1481e3ae6f
spent
true